Abstract The Pleistocene is a key period for understanding the evolutionary history and palaeobiogeography of the European rabbit (Oryctolagus cuniculus). The species was first documented in southeastern Iberia at the beginning of the Middle Pleistocene and appears to have rapidly spread throughout Southwestern Europe, where it was found in numerous ...

Latent Diffusion Models for Virtual Battery Material Screening and Characterization
A newly developed virtual tool is designed to enhance the extraction of meaningful information from characterization technique data and effectively guides the screening of target battery materials based on functional requirements. Efficient characterization of battery materials is fundamental to understanding the underlying electrochemical mechanisms ...
